ANCHORAGE, Alaska -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A), Alaska Division of Homeland Security & Emergency Management (DHS&EM), and Small Business Administration (SBA) Disaster Assistance staff will be in Russian Mission to help survivors register for assistance from the ice jam and snow melt flooding that occurred between May 12 and June 3, 2023.    

Teams will set up at the City Office to register survivors for disaster assistance and answer questions about the application process and what happens next. Immediately following registration, housing inspectors will travel to the applicants’ homes to perform a home inspection. FEMA staff will always have appropriate federal identification and will never charge for assistance.
